The D7 class battle cruiser was a type of warship designed and built by the Klingon Empire during the mid 23rd century. Many also entered the service of the Romulan Star Empire following the formation of a Klingon-Romulan alliance in the 2260s. (TOS episodes: "Elaan of Troyius", "The Enterprise Incident", "Day of the Dove")

[edit] History
The D7-class was the next step in Klingon battle cruiser design, its form being a development of the earlier D4 class. The first prototypes entered service as early as 2151 (ENT episode: "Unexpected")
By the mid 23rd century the class had become the mainstay of the fleet. Following the formation of a Klingon-Romulan alliance in the 2260s, many D7s entered service in the Romulan Star Empire as Stormbird-class cruisers. (TOS episode: "The Enterprise Incident," FASA RPG: The Romulans: Star Fleet Intelligence Manual).
A variant of this cruiser was the D7-A, which saw use as early as 2269. (FASA RPG: Star Trek IV Sourcebook Update).
A significant class variant was the D7-M or K't'inga-class. (FASA RPG: Star Trek IV Sourcebook Update).
[edit] Variants
The D7 class name describes any number of variants of the class, which included many individually named and numbered series.
- Akif-class (battle cruiser)
- Klolode-class (D7-D5)
- K't'agga-class ("Painbringer", D7A cruiser)
- K't'kara-class ("Bringer of Destiny", D7C cruiser)
- K't'alla-class ("Truthbringer", D7G cruiser)
- K't'inga-class ("Bringer of Destruction", D7M cruiser/battle cruiser)
- K't'rika-class ("Bringer of Agony", D7R cruiser)
- K't'mara-class ("Bringer of Justice", D7S cruiser)
- Koloth-class (frigate)
The Romulan-owned D7s were referred to as Stormbird-class vessels, and that class name seems to refer to multiple types listed above, most notably the Akif and K't'inga-classes.
